Efficacy of hyperbaric oxygen combined with donepezil in the treatment of Alzheimer's disease and its impact on the levels of serum humanin and endothelin-1
Objective To investigate the efficacy of hyperbaric oxygen combined with donepezil in the treatment of Alzheimer's disease(AD),and its effects on serum humanin and endothelin-1(ET-1).Methods A total of 98 patients with AD treated in Shanghai Mental Health Center of Shanghai Jiao Tong University School of Medicine from January 2021 to January 2024 were selected and randomly divided into a control group and an observation group according to the random number table method.The control group was treated with donepezil hydrochloride,while the observation group was treated with hyperbaric oxygen therapy on the basis of the treatment in the control group.Both groups were treated for 7 weeks.The scores of the cognition part of the AD assessment scale(ADAS-cog),the mini-mental state examination(MMSE),the Montreal cognitive assessment(MoCA),the neuropsychiatric inventory(NPI),the activities of daily living(ADL)before and after treatment,as well as the levels of serum humanin and ET-1,efficacy,and incidence of adverse reactions were compared.Results After treatment,the MMSE and MoCA scores of the observation group were higher than those of the control group,and the ADAS-cog score was lower than that of the control group,and the differences were all statistically significant(P<0.05).Before treatment,there was no statistically significant difference in NPI and ADL scores between the two groups of patients(P>0.05).After treatment,the ADL score of the observation group was higher than that of the control group,and the NPI score was lower than that of the control group,and the differences were both statistically significant(P<0.05).Before treatment,there was no statistically significant difference in the levels of serum humanin and ET-1 between the two groups of patients(P>0.05).After treatment,the serum humanin level of the observation group was higher than that of the control group,and the ET-1 level was lower than that of the control group,and the differences were both statistically significant(P<0.05).The total incidence of adverse reactions in the observation group and the control group were 12.24%(6/49)and 10.20%(5/49),respectively,and the difference was not statistically significant(P>0.05).Conclusion The efficacy of hyperbaric oxygen combined with donepezil in the treatment of AD is better than that of donepezil alone,which can increase the serum humanin level,reduce the ET-1 level,improve the cognitive function and mental disorders of AD patients,and enhance patients'activities of daily living,and the treatment has relatively good safety.
